The Forbidden Photos Of A Lady Above Suspicion 1970 Screenplay by Ernesto Gastaldi and Mahnahén Velasco, directed by Luciano Ercoli. Score by Ennio Morricone.
A rich woman is attacked by a man who tells her that her husband is a murderer. He later plays her a tape of her husband plotting to murder a man that the newspapers say was just found dead. The attacker tells her he'll give her the tape if she has sex with him. They meet up and he secretly photos their activity. When she takes the police to where it all happened, they find is a dusty unused house. The attacker scares the wife a few times and the police help out. This all goes on for a while, there's a lot of yakking and a small bit of nudity and sex. Nothing happens much of the time and it's kind of pokey. There's a bit of a twist at the end but it wasn't much of a surprise. Not bad but not something I would probably watch again.
